Job Summary:
The Cybersecurity Program Manager role involves providing program governance client coordination and delivery oversight for all task authorizations. This role serves as the primary point of contact and requires managing task orders schedules deliverables incident response escalation and resource allocation. The Program Manager will also ensure adherence to security frameworks provide executive reporting and coordinate after-hours operations.
Location:San Diego California United States
Responsibilities:
- Serve as the primary point of contact.
- Manage task orders schedules and deliverables.
- Coordinate incident response escalation.
- Manage resource allocation across cybersecurity services.
- Ensure adherence to NIST PCI DSS CIS18 ISO27001 frameworks.
- Provide executive reporting and project updates.
- Ensure after-hours operations coordination.
Required Skills & Certifications:
- Cybersecurity program governance
- Public sector / critical infrastructure security
- Risk management frameworks
- Incident coordination
- Vendor and stakeholder management
- PMP / CAPM / Project
- 10 years cybersecurity experience
- 5 years managing enterprise cybersecurity programs
Preferred Skills & Certifications:
- CISSP or CISM
Special Considerations:
- Must be able to coordinate after-hours operations.
Scheduling:
- Includes work windows from midnight 4 AM.
